What are common challenges faced during a content audit?

Identifying Obstacles in Your Audit Process

Taking stock of all your existing content is a big step toward seeing what’s performing, what needs improvement, and where fresh opportunities lie. But while following any solid content audit guide, it’s easy to bump into tricky challenges.

1. Lack of Clear Objectives
Many audits falter because goals aren’t defined up front, making it difficult to figure out if your content is truly successful. Setting measurable benchmarks—like engagement metrics or lead conversions—keeps you on track.

2. Inconsistent Brand Formatting and Tone
Over time, style guidelines can drift, especially if multiple people create content. Regularly reviewing for consistency can help maintain a cohesive voice that resonates with your audience.

3. Gaps and Overlaps
Without a systematic approach, some topics may be underrepresented while others are repeated multiple times. Identifying content gaps or overlaps ensures your library remains both comprehensive and easy to navigate.

4. Unclear Performance Data
Gathering reliable analytics—for instance, which pages convert best or where visitors drop off—can be complex. Yet this data is crucial in separating what’s hitting the mark from what needs optimization.

5. Time Constraints and Workflow Bottlenecks
Audits can be time-consuming. Busy teams often struggle to keep the process moving smoothly and end up postponing improvements. Breaking the audit into manageable phases can help avoid a backlog.
